Output 381c633888cd9e564c373b5774ff4161f5d7a2d2c5268040a4dd07e4d6838f6d:0

value
245294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21258c4f0da8c49d4451871273f60e28f0d96a10 OP_EQUAL
address
34iHCm4r1ZpPghML6oS1iDkVWv4tRBf3y8
transaction
381c633888cd9e564c373b5774ff4161f5d7a2d2c5268040a4dd07e4d6838f6d